Bangladesh cricketer Shakib al Hasan has signed with Pakistan Super League (PSL) franchise Lahore Qalandars. The all-rounder, who has been out of action for nearly six months now, will link up with the franchise and will play the remainder of PSL 10. The tournament will restart on May 17 after it was temporarily suspended amid tensions between India and Pakistan.

Shakib returns to action in PSL
As per bdnews24.com, Shakib confirmed to the publication that he will be a part of PSL 10. This will be the all-rounder’s third stint in the league. Previously, Hasan played for Karachi Kings in 2016 and Peshawar Zalmi in 2017. His re-entry into PSL comes 8 years after his last stint.
Shakib will play alongside Bangladesh teammate Rishad Hossain in Lahore Qalandars. The team is currently fourth on the PSL 10 standings with 9 points from as many number of games.
Shakib last played in the Abu Dhabi T10 League for the Bangla Tigers. His last international appearance came in the Asia Cup in September. He did not take part in the Champions Trophy either.
Meanwhile, Shakib was reported by the standing umpire during a game for Surrey in the County Championship for suspected bowling action. After failing a reassessment test twice, he managed to clear it on the third occasion earlier in March and was allowed to bowl once again.
